The City of Marion has released a first-look at concept designs for a proposed 4-court Marion Basketball Stadium earmarked to replace the 50-year-old facility at Norfolk Road.

Marion Council endorsed the concept plans for public consultation, including a budget of $30 million-plus, which will open on Monday.

Residents will have an opportunity to view the designs – by Studio Nine Architects - and provide feedback about the initial scope of the project.

The feedback will be presented to Council in May and, if endorsed, more detailed designs will be prepared in the second half of the year.

Construction is expected to commence in 2026.

The project has been made possible thanks to the Australian Government delivering on a $6 million funding commitment under the Priority Community Infrastructure Program to assist in constructing this much-needed facility in Adelaide’s south.

The South Adelaide Basketball Club (SABC) has been lobbying for a new facility to meet the needs of over 2000 members.

The club currently utilises 31 indoor courts per week and only 7 are at council-owned facilities. 

The existing Marion Basketball Stadium is over 60 years old and no longer meets the functional requirements of the sport. 

Council staff will work with SABC to develop a preferred management model and lease arrangement for the new stadium. 

The new basketball facility would be located on the Marion Sports Precinct which is currently home to at least 12 sports and organisations and is situated right in the heart of the City of Marion. 

The new basketball facility will see the Marion Tennis Club relocated to the southern side of the precinct at the old croquet club site. Four new courts will be constructed.

There is also good news for cricket with Marion Council agreeing to contribute to new practice nets if the club can secure a grant from the state government.
